      <description>&lt;P&gt;I have a Pixel 6a on the latest updates.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;For me the expanation mark shows up on the mobile data indicator on the status bar when I manually turn off data in the settings. When I toggle data back on the exclamaiton mark disappears.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If I remember correctly (it's been a while...) the data toggle was automatically set to on when I first put the Public Mobile SIM. I'm on the $15 plan and turn data off manually when I'm in WiFi range / don't need data.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Edited to add: On my previous phone (a 2017 Sony Experia Z3) the exclamation mark showed up when I'd used all my data and was cut-off for the month.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/284011"&gt;@phone_problems&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;seeing the exclamation mark when mobile data is disabled is normal... by the way keep the preferred network on LTE as leaving it on auto recommended will enable the 5g radio which will use more battery and might cause compatibility issues with some towers. PM also doesn't support 5g&lt;/P&gt;</description>
